3. PUBLIC FORUM
Statements and Petitions
Any local resident or Councillor, provided they have given notice in writing or by electronic mail to the Service Director, Legal Services not later than 12 noon the working day before the day of the meeting, may present a petition or submit a statement on the work of the Public Safety and Protection Committee. In the case of a statement, a copy of the submission should be included.
The notice should be addressed to the Democratic Services Office (Room 220), The Council House, College Green, Bristol BS1 5TR and marked for the attention of Norman Cornthwaite. E-mails should be sent to democratic.services@bristol.gov.uk
Please note that for copyright reasons, we are unable to reproduce or publish newspaper or magazine articles that may be attached to statements as supporting documentation.
The total time allowed for public forum business is 30 minutes.
